Bogong is a village situated in Roing circle of Lower Dibang Valley district in Arunachal Pradesh. As per the Population Census 2011, there are a total of 19 families residing in the village Bogong. The total population of Bogong is 103 out of which 49 are males and 54 are females thus the Average Sex Ratio of Bogong is 1,102.

The population of Children aged 0-6 years in Bogong village is 9 which is 9% of the total population. There are 5 male children and 4 female children between the age 0-6 years. Thus as per the Census 2011 the Child Sex Ratio of Bogong is 800 which is less than Average Sex Ratio (1,102) of Bogong village.

As per the Census 2011, the literacy rate of Bogong is 56.4%. Thus Bogong village has a lower literacy rate compared to 58.9% of Lower Dibang Valley district. The male literacy rate is 68.18% and the female literacy rate is 46% in Bogong village.

Caste Data as per Census 2011

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 0% while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 99% of total population in Bogong village.


Working Population as per Census 2011

In Bogong village out of total population, 24 were engaged in work activities. 95.8% of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 4.2% were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 24 workers engaged in Main Work, 21 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 0 were Agricultural labourers.
